Learning Objectives
5 objectives- Understand the role and impact of technology in special education, including its benefits and challenges.
- Identify and evaluate various assistive technology devices and software that support students with disabilities.
- Apply principles of Universal Design for Learning (UDL) to create inclusive learning environments using technology.
- Develop skills to create accessible digital content and use emerging technologies such as augmented and virtual reality in special education.
- Recognize ethical, legal, and professional considerations when integrating technology into special education.
Content Outline
PreviewUnit 1879: Technology in Special Education
1. Introduction to Technology in Special Education
- Definition and scope of technology in special education
- Benefits of technology integration for students with disabilities
- Challenges and barriers to technology use
- Overview of assistive technologies and their impact
2. Assistive Technology Devices
- Communication devices (e.g., speech-generating devices, AAC tools)
- Adaptive keyboards and mice
- Screen readers and magnification tools
- Switches and alternative input devices
- Case studies: Matching devices to student needs
3. Universal Design for Learning (UDL)
- Principles of UDL: Engagement, Representation, Action & Expression
- Role of technology in supporting UDL frameworks
- Designing flexible learning environments
- Examples of technology tools supporting UDL
4. Apps and Software for Special Education
- Educational apps tailored for various disabilities (e.g., dyslexia, autism, visual impairments)
- Communication apps and augmentative communication software
- Behavior management and self-regulation tools
- Criteria for selecting appropriate apps and software
5. Augmented and Virtual Reality in Special Education
- Definitions and differences between AR and VR
- Applications of AR/VR for experiential learning and skill practice
- Virtual simulations for social skills and daily living
- Accessibility considerations in AR/VR environments
6. Creating Accessible Digital Content
- Principles of digital accessibility (WCAG guidelines overview)
- Techniques for accessible documents (e.g., alt text, headings, contrast)
- Creating accessible videos (captions, transcripts, audio descriptions)
- Designing accessible websites and learning platforms
7. Data Collection and Progress Monitoring
- Importance of data-driven instruction
- Digital tools for tracking student performance and progress
- Using technology for behavior and intervention monitoring
- Data privacy and security considerations
8. Professional Development for Educators
- Importance of continuous learning in technology integration
- Training models and resources for special education technology
- Collaborative learning and peer support networks
- Evaluating effectiveness of professional development
9. Ethical and Legal Considerations
- Privacy laws and regulations (FERPA, IDEA, ADA)
- Accessibility compliance requirements
- Equity of access and avoiding technology disparities
- Ethical use of student data and digital tools
Summary: This unit provides a comprehensive understanding of how technology enhances special education, equipping educators with knowledge, skills, and ethical frameworks to support diverse learners effectively.
